From WordNet (r) 3.0 (2006) [wn]:
Salsola kali
n
  1. bushy plant of Old World salt marshes and sea beaches having prickly leaves; burned to produce a crude soda ash
    Synonym(s): saltwort, barilla, glasswort, kali, kelpwort, Salsola kali, Salsola soda

From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913) [web1913]:
   Glasswort \Glass"wort`\, n. (Bot.)
      A seashore plant of the Spinach family ({Salicornia
      herbacea}), with succulent jointed stems; also, a prickly
      plant of the same family ({Salsola Kali}), both formerly
      burned for the sake of the ashes, which yield soda for making
      glass and soap.
